The 28th North Carolina Infantry Regiment was a North Carolinian infantry regiment of the Confederate States Army that was active from September 1861 to April 1865 during the American Civil War. Raised in Surry, Gaston, Catawba, Stanley, Montgomery, Yadkin, Orange, and Cleveland counties, the regiment was attached to the Army of Northern Virginia from the Battle of Hanover Court House to the Appomattox campaign, suffering 33% casualties at the Seven Days Battles and 40% casualties at the Battle of Gettysburg.
